Belif’s Moisturizing Eye Bomb is as refreshing as it gets.
The gel-like cream formula provides an intense hit of hydration viaglycerinandsqualane, instantly softening my stressed skin.
It never leaves behind a greasy film like heavier creams do.

I fell in love with the green-tinted Osea Hyaluronic Sea Serum that hasthreedifferent molecular weights of hyaluronic acid.
It’s also packed with three types of seaweed for extrahydration benefitswith a bit of plumping action.
Plus, it smells really yummy."
